安裝Python的MySQL Connector需要用PiP進行下載與安裝,
群暉NAS並未內建PIP的功能,因此需自行安裝才可使用。
一、安裝PiP套件
首先使用Curl下載並安裝PiP套件
curl -k https://bootstrap.pypa.io/get-pip.py | python3
接著可能會出現錯誤訊息:「WARNING: The scripts pip, pip3 and pip3.8 are installed in '/var/services/homes/*****/.local/bin' which is not on PATH.Consider adding this directory to PATH or, if you prefer to suppress this warning, use --no-warn-script-location.」
因為路徑尚未設置環境變數,因此如果下PiP指令可能會找不到指令。
將路徑Export,複製錯誤訊息上的路徑,然後:
export PATH=$PATH:/var/services/homes/*****/.local/bin
輸入完畢就可以使用PiP了
二、安裝MySQL Connector
首先安裝套件
pip install mysql-connector-python
安裝完後即在可於Python裡面import
import mysql.connector
連接資料庫:
mydb = mysql.connector.connect(
host="localhost",
port="yourport",
user="yourusername",
password="yourpassword",
database="mydatabase"
)
參考資料:
[1]Python MySQL
https://www.w3schools.com/python/python_mysql_getstarted.asp
[2]Synology群辉NAS Python 3如何安装PIP
https://www.itgeeker.net/synology-nas-install-python3-pip/
沒有留言:
張貼留言